Live-Charts图表导出功能实战秘籍:高效保存数据可视化的终极方案
【免费下载链接】Live-ChartsSimple, flexible, interactive & powerful charts, maps and gauges for .Net项目地址: https://gitcode.com/gh_mirrors/li/Live-Charts
Live-Charts作为一款功能强大的.NET图表库,其图表导出功能为用户提供了将动态数据可视化成果转化为静态图片的便捷途径。通过简单的API调用,开发者能够将精心设计的图表保存为多种格式,满足报告制作、演示展示和文档归档等多样化需求。
🔍 图表导出的核心价值与应用场景
图表导出功能在实际项目中具有不可替代的价值,主要体现在以下几个关键场景:
数据报告制作:将交互式图表转换为高质量图片,嵌入到Word、PDF等文档中演示文稿制作:为PowerPoint等演示工具提供专业的数据可视化素材网页内容嵌入:生成适用于网页展示的图表图片,提升用户体验团队协作分享:将图表以图片形式分享给非技术背景的团队成员
🛠️ 导出功能架构解析
Live-Charts的图表导出功能采用分层架构设计,确保功能的高效性和扩展性:
| 层级 | 功能模块 | 核心职责 |
|---|---|---|
| 核心层 | ChartCore.cs | 提供基础的图表渲染和导出逻辑 |
| 视图层 | Chart.cs | 实现用户界面的导出交互 |
| 配置层 | Mappers相关类 | 定义图表元素的映射规则 |
📈 导出格式选择策略
根据不同的使用场景,选择合适的图片格式至关重要:
PNG格式
- ✅ 支持透明背景,适合嵌入到不同风格的文档中
- ✅ 无损压缩,保证图片质量
- ✅ 适用于需要精确展示图表细节的场景
JPG格式
- ✅ 文件体积较小,适合网络传输
- ✅ 兼容性极佳,几乎所有设备都能正常显示
- ⚠️ 不支持透明背景,可能影响整体视觉效果
🎯 高效导出操作指南
准备工作流程
环境配置:通过命令获取项目源码
git clone https://gitcode.com/gh_mirrors/li/Live-Charts图表渲染:确保图表数据完全加载并正确显示
参数设置:根据目标用途调整导出分辨率和质量参数
最佳实践要点
- 在导出前验证图表数据的完整性和准确性
- 为导出的图片建立规范的命名体系
- 考虑使用异步导出机制,避免界面响应延迟
💼 企业级应用案例
在大型企业数据分析平台中,Live-Charts的导出功能发挥着重要作用:
实时监控报告:将实时数据图表定期导出,生成监控报告历史数据归档:保存重要时间节点的图表快照,便于后续分析多格式适配:根据不同部门的需求,生成相应格式的图表图片
🔮 未来发展趋势
随着数据可视化需求的不断增长,图表导出功能将继续演进:
- 支持更多图片格式和编码选项
- 提供更精细的质量控制参数
- 集成云端存储和分享功能
通过掌握Live-Charts的图表导出功能,开发者能够将动态的数据分析结果转化为可持久保存的视觉资产,大大提升了数据可视化的实用价值和传播效率。这一功能不仅简化了图表的使用流程,更为数据驱动的决策提供了强有力的支持。
【免费下载链接】Live-ChartsSimple, flexible, interactive & powerful charts, maps and gauges for .Net项目地址: https://gitcode.com/gh_mirrors/li/Live-Charts
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考